
There Season 3 of the eighth year of Rainbow Six Siege is here and with it some new features, such as a new operator and a new model for quick games. Among the various functions introduced, there is one that allows you to choose the graphics card when our PC hosts more than one, for example an iGPU flanked by one NVIDIA GeForce RTX 4090 Ti. Yes, you read that correctly.
As you can see from the image, Ubisoft included in the sample screen the name of the graphics card, which NVIDIA never revealed (but didn’t deny either). We reported on the latest rumors about a new top-of-the-line model at the end of last month and They suggested that NVIDIA should scrap an improved variant of its top-of-the-line product.
On X (formerly Twitter) kopite7kimi, a leaker who has proven himself reliable several times, claimed that NVIDIA had ruled out a new flagship for the Ada Lovelace series and would already be working on the next generation, the hypothetical one GeForce RTX 5090.
However, how we wrote at the presentation of the GeForce RTX 4090, the AD102 chip in the above graphics card does not appear in its complete form. NVIDIA’s current flagship features 16384 CUDA core e 128 RT core while full resources reach i 18432 CUDA core e 144 RT core.
It’s clear that it could be a simple typo, especially considering that in the example image the selected resolution ends at Full HD and the refresh rate a 60Hza configuration that wouldn’t cause problems for cards significantly below the GeForce RTX 4090.
